PROBLEM TO BE SOLVED: To achieve a turbidity/color meter which has an optics structure as a part for detecting a turbidity value and a color value, and has a compensating means for variations in light intensity of a lamp. SOLUTION: The turbidity/color meter is provided with: a light irradiation means for irradiating a measurement liquid with light, which is prepared in a transparent vessel and contains particulate; a first photodetector for measuring a turbidity-related intensity of light passing through the measurement liquid; a second photodetector for measuring turbidity-related intensity of light scattered by the particulate; and a third photodetector for measuring color-related intensity of the light passing through the measurement liquid. The turbidity/color meter is characterized by further being provided with a means for compensating error due to variations in a light source power-supply voltage, which compensates the error of a detection signal of the third photodetector, due to the variations in a power-supply voltage of a light source, from a first ratio in the time when the first ratio and a second ratio vary at the same rate, wherein the first ratio is obtained by a dividing detected light intensity of the first photodetector at a measurement timing by detected light intensity of the first photodetector at a prescribed preceding timing, and the second ratio is obtained by a dividing detected light intensity of the second photodetector at the measurement timing by a detected light intensity of the second photodetector at the prescribed preceding timing.
